Page 2 - Modul 8
P. 2

Tabel 4.1 Anomali Perubahan


























                       Permasalahan :
                       Bagaimana cara menyimpan data bila terdapat fakta ada ruang baru dengan nama A

                       501 yang terdapat pada lantai 5 ?

                       Penyisipan tidak dapat dilakukan mengingat tidak ada / belum ada perkuliahan yang
                       menggunakan ruang tersebut.


                      I.2  Anomali Pengubahan (update anomaly)

                               Anomali  pengubahan  terjadi  apabila  pengubahan  pada  sejumlah  data  yang

                      memiliki  duplikasi  tetapi  tidak  seluruhnya  diubah.  Sebagai  contoh  adalah  sebagai
                      berikut :

                                               Tabel 4.2 Anomali Pengubahan (1)



















                               Seandainya  pemasok  Bahagia  pindah  ke  kota  lain  misalnya  Semarang  dan
                      pengubahan  hanya  dilakukan  pada  data  yang  pertama  (data  pemasok  Bahagia  pada

                      relasi Pemasok ada 2 buah) maka hasilnya akan menyebabkan ketidakkonsistenan. Bila
                      kota pemasok Bahagia diubah, maka :


                                                            2
   1   2   3   4   5   6   7